Skif_off
Gold Member |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ору karavan Цитата: Все зависит от реализации внутри deb-пакета | Хорошо, сформулирую по другому Допустим, есть что-то простое, без разных preinst, postinst и прочего, только control и md5sums, запускаем sudo dpkg -i name_N_A.deb: - dpkg проверяет целостность; - проверяет зависимости; - распаковывает data.tar.??; - что происходит теперь? Цитата: Исполнение любых команд из разархивированного тарбола идет мимо менеджера пакетов. | Да, поэтому хочу понять, что ещё происходит, после того, как deb-файл установлен и все его частные триггеры завершены: что-то, что нужно сделать и после распаковки тарбола. Не знаю, принудительное обновление кэша иконок? Mime-типов? desktop-файл вон подхватывается без вопросов, почему не помогла тупо перезагрузка, ведь все значки лежат по нужным папкам? Если редактировать меню, используя ~/.local/share/applications и ~/.local/share/icons, то достаточно update-desktop-database и xfdesktop --reload, чтобы всё подхватилось и работало, тут не срабатывает... Цитата: Значит внутри тарбола это ни как не реализовано | Ну, в данном случае это просто архив, но дело и не в нём. P.S. С репозиторием на openSUSE Build Service были свои сложности. | Всего записей: 6655 | Зарегистр. 28-01-2008 | Отправлено: 01:55 06-02-2018 | Исправлено: Skif_off, 02:04 06-02-2018 |
|